Center Point home prices fall in December 2017

Re 6

The median sale price of a home sold in December 2017 in Center Point fell by $4,000 while total sales decreased by 57.1%, according to BlockShopper.com.

In December 2017, there were three homes sold, with a median sale price of $163,000 - a 2.4% decrease over the $167,000 median sale price for the same period of the previous year. There were seven homes sold in Center Point in December 2016.

The median sales tax in Center Point for 2017 was $3,019. In 2016, the median sales tax was $2,923. This marks an increase of 3.3%. The effective property tax rate, using the median property tax and median home sale price as the basis, is 1.9%.
